Ein Dateipfad ist eine Zeichenfolge, die den Speicherort einer Datei auf einem Computersystem identifiziert. Es besteht aus einer Folge von Komponenten, von denen jede ein Verzeichnis oder Unterverzeichnis in der Dateisystemhierarchie darstellt.
Die Komponenten eines Dateipfads sind wie folgt:
* Das Stammverzeichnis: Dies ist das oberste Verzeichnis des Dateisystems. In Windows wird das Stammverzeichnis durch den Laufwerksbuchstaben dargestellt, z. B. „C:“. In Unix-basierten Systemen wird das Stammverzeichnis durch einen Schrägstrich „/“ dargestellt.
* Verzeichnisse: Verzeichnisse sind Unterverzeichnisse des Stammverzeichnisses. Sie werden erstellt, um Dateien in logischen Gruppen zu organisieren. Verzeichnisse werden durch ihren Namen dargestellt, beispielsweise „Dokumente“ oder „Bilder“.
* Unterverzeichnisse: Unterverzeichnisse sind Verzeichnisse, die sich innerhalb anderer Verzeichnisse befinden. Sie werden verwendet, um Dateien weiter in kleinere Gruppen zu organisieren. Unterverzeichnisse werden durch ihren Namen dargestellt, z. B. „Eigene Dateien“ oder „Meine Bilder“.
* Dateiname: Der Dateiname ist der Name der Datei selbst. Er besteht typischerweise aus zwei Teilen:dem Basisnamen und die Erweiterung. Der Basisname ist der Hauptname der Datei, z. B. „myfile“. Die Erweiterung ist ein Suffix, das den Dateityp angibt, z. B. „.txt“ oder „.exe“.
Zum Beispiel Der folgende Dateipfad identifiziert den Speicherort einer Datei namens „myfile.txt“ im Verzeichnis „Dokumente“ auf dem Laufwerk „C:“:
„
C:\Dokumente\meineDatei.txt
„
Dateipfade können entweder absolut oder relativ sein. Ein absoluter Dateipfad gibt den vollständigen Pfad vom Stammverzeichnis zur Datei an. Ein relativer Dateipfad gibt den Pfad vom aktuellen Arbeitsverzeichnis zur Datei an.
Zum Beispiel Der folgende absolute Dateipfad identifiziert den Speicherort einer Datei namens „myfile.txt“ im Verzeichnis „Documents“ auf dem Laufwerk „C:“:
„
/Benutzer/Benutzername/Dokumente/meineDatei.txt
„
Der folgende relative Dateipfad identifiziert den Speicherort einer Datei namens „myfile.txt“ im Verzeichnis „Dokumente“:
„
Dokumente/meineDatei.txt
„